The bike tour along the shores of Lake Mondsee is one of the most scenic routes in the Salzkammergut. Starting on the northern shore of the lake, the trail leads past quiet coves and reed-lined shorelines, offering almost continuous, magnificent views of the crystal-clear waters and the imposing Drachenwand mountain in the background. Especially in the morning or late afternoon, the light over the lake is magical – perfect for a short rest. Cycling the route counterclockwise offers the best views of the lake and mountains, especially at sunset. Bring your swimsuit; some of the most beautiful access points to the lake are hidden but easily accessible by bike.

The lakes near Thalgau, often considered the gateway to the Salzkammergut, are renowned for their stunning natural beauty. They are set amidst an imposing mountain landscape, featuring crystal-clear waters that reflect the surrounding peaks. Each lake offers a distinct charm, from the warm, shimmering green waters of Lake Mondsee to the turquoise-blue clarity of Fuschlsee and the dramatic mountainous backdrop of Lake Wolfgang.
For swimming, Lake Mondsee is an excellent choice, known as one of the warmest lakes in the region with summer temperatures reaching up to 27 degrees Celsius. Fuschlsee is also very popular for its crystal-clear, pristine waters and numerous spots for sunbathing along its rocky shores. The Northern lakeside path on Lake Fuschl offers many accessible swimming spots.
Yes, many lakes offer family-friendly activities. Lake Mondsee has accessible beaches and cycling paths suitable for families. The Northern lakeside path on Lake Fuschl is also ideal for families, with clean water and free parking. Lake Wolfgang offers swimming, paddleboarding, and ferry boat rides, which are popular with all ages.

Yes, fishing is a popular activity, particularly at Fuschlsee. Its pristine waters offer ample opportunities to test your skills and catch various fish species. You can find a nice rest stop at the fishing area near the castle hotel on Fuschlsee, where fresh smoked fish is often available.
The lakes are surrounded by impressive natural landmarks. The Kienbergwand Tunnel and Lakeside Trail (Mondsee) offers unique views of Lake Mondsee through its galleries. Fuschlsee is framed by the imposing Drachenwand mountain, visible from the Northern lakeside path. Lake Wolfgang boasts the impressive Schafberg Mountain, which you can ascend via a cog railway for panoramic views.

The summer months are ideal for swimming and water sports, especially given the warm temperatures of Lake Mondsee.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ures for cycling and hiking, with beautiful foliage in the fall. Even winter has its charm, with events like the idyllic Christmas Market stalls in St. Gilgen on Lake Wolfgang.
